More Progress:

 

I removed the hd cage, sanded the parts and primed. Waited 24 hours sanded and primed again. Another 24 hours later here's what I got.

 

1000838yl3.jpg

1000840qd8.jpg

1000844ze6.jpg

 

Next I will be painting the case black (flat or semi), followed by a clear coat. :D

More Progress:

 

Here's the 2nd coat of flat black 2hrs dry time. The parts hanging from wire allows to cover all sides. (I sanded between coats and applied the 2nd coat after 24hrs of drying.)
